Working
This Branch undertakes different activities with regard to the Institute. All accounts of the Institute have been computerized and the accounts regarding receipts and payments of the University are maintained in a manner prescribed by the Government. The receipts and expenditure are reconciled with Treasury Office/Admin Office. An expenditure statement is prepared on monthly basis and sent to Dean and Chairman for information.
The Finance Branch also pre-audits the payment of remunerations to the paper-setters, paper-assessors, examiners etc. It also deals with the refund cases of the students. All payments relating to salary, T.A., D.A. etc. of the employees of the IHMS are made by the Finance Branch of the Institute. This branch is also responsible for coordinating the conduct of statutory audit and the replies of audit paras afterward.
